TheAmericanDreammeansdifferentthingstodifferentpeople.Butformany,particularlyimmigrants,itmeanstheopportunitytomakeabetterlifeforthemselves.ForthemthedreamisthattalentandhardworkcantakeyoufromlogcabintoWhiteHouse.TonyTrivisonnodidnotrisequitesohigh,yethemanagedtomakehisowndreamcometrue.
TONYTRIVISONNO'SAMERICANDREAM
FrederickC.Crawford
HecamefromarockyfarminItaly,somewheresouthofRome.HoworwhenhegottoAmerica,Idon'tknow.ButoneeveningIfoundhimstandinginthedriveway,behindmygarage.Hewasaboutfive-foot-sevenoreight,andthin.
Imowyourlawn,hesaid.ItwashardtocomprehendhisbrokenEnglish.
Iaskedhimhisname.TonyTrivisonno,hereplied.Imowyourlawn.ItoldTonythatIcouldn'taffordagardener.
Imowyourlawn,hesaidagain,thenwalkedaway.Iwentintomyhouseunhappy.Yes,theseDepressiondaysweredifficult,buthowcouldItoturnawayapersonwhohadcometomeforhelp?
WhenIgothomefromworkthenextevening,thelawnhadbeenmowed,thegardenweeded,andthewalksswept.Iaskedmywifewhathadhappened.
Amangotthelawnmoweroutofthegarageandworkedontheyard,sheanswered.Iassumedyouhadhiredhim.
Itoldherofmyexperiencethenightbefore.Wethoughtitstrangethathehadnotaskedforpay.
Thenexttwodayswerebusy,andIforgotaboutTony.Weweretryingtorebuildourbusinessandbringsomeofourworkersbacktotheplants.ButonFriday,returninghomealittleearly,IsawTonyagain,behindthegarage.Icomplimentedhimontheworkhehaddone.
Imowyourlawn,hesaid.
Imanagedtoworkoutsomekindofsmallweeklypay,andeachdayTonycleaneduptheyardandtookcareofanylittletasks.Mywifesaidhewasveryhelpfulwhenevertherewereanyheavyobjectstoliftorthingstofix.
Summerpassedintofall,andwindsblewcold.Mr.Craw,snowprettysoon,Tonytoldmeoneevening.Whenwintercome,yougivemejobclearingsnowatthefactory.
Well,whatdoyoudowithsuchdeterminationandhope?Ofcourse,Tonygothisjobatthefactory.
Themonthspassed.Iaskedthepersonneldepartmentforareport.TheysaidTonywasaverygoodworker.
OnedayIfoundTonyatourmeetingplacebehindthegarage.Iwanttobe'prentice,hesaid.
Wehadaprettygoodapprenticeschoolthattrainedlaborers.ButIdoubtedwhetherTonyhadthecapacitytoreadblueprintsandmicrometersordoprecisionwork.Still,howcouldIturnhimdown?
Tonytookacutinpaytobecomeanapprentice.Monthslater,Igotareportthathehadgraduatedasaskilledgrinder.Hehadlearnedtoreadthemillionthsofaninchonthemicrometerandtoshapethegrindingwheelwithaninstrumentsetwithadiamond.MywifeandIweredelightedwithwhatwefeltwasasatisfyingendofthestory.
Ayearortwopassed,andagainIfoundTonyinhisusualwaitingplace.Wetalkedabouthiswork,andIaskedhimwhathewanted.
Mr.Craw,hesaid,Ilikeabuyahouse.Ontheedgeoftown,hehadfoundahouseforsale,acompletewreck.
Icalledonabankerfriend.Doyoueverloanmoneyoncharacter?Iasked.No,hesaid.Wecan'taffordto.Nosale.
Now,waitaminute,Ireplied.Hereisahard-workingman,amanofcharacter,Icanpromiseyouthat.He'sgotagoodjob.You'renotgettingadamnthingfromyourlot.Itwillstaythereforyears.Atleasthewillpayyourinterest.
Reluctantly,thebankerwroteamortgagefor$2,000andgaveTonythehousewithnodownpayment.Tonywasdelighted.Fromthenon,itwasinterestingtoseethatanydiscardedoddsandendsaroundourplaceabrokenscreen,abitofhardware,boardsfrompackingTonywouldgatherandtakehome.
Afterabouttwoyears,IfoundTonyinourfamiliarmeetingspot.Heseemedtostandalittlestraighter.Hewasheavier.Hehadalookofconfidence.
Mr.Craw,Isellmyhouse!hesaidwithpride.Igot$8,000.
Iwasamazed.But,Tony,whereareyougoingtolivewithoutahouse?
Mr.Craw,Ibuyafarm.
Wesatdownandtalked.Tonytoldmethattoownafarmwashisdream.HelovedthetomatoesandpeppersandalltheothervegetablesimportanttohisItaliandiet.HehadsentforhiswifeandsonanddaughterbackinItaly.Hehadhuntedaroundtheedgeoftownuntilhefoundasmall,abandonedpieceofpropertywithahouseandshed.Nowhewasmovinghisfamilytohisfarm.
Sometimelater.TonyarrivedonaSundayafternoon,neatlydressed.HehadanotherItalianmanwithhim.HetoldmethathehadpersuadedhischildhoodfriendtomovetoAmerica.Tonywassponsoringhim.Withanamusedlookinhiseye,hetoldmethatwhentheyapproachedthelittlefarmhenowoperated,hisfriendstoodinamazementandsaid,Tony,youareamillionaire!
Then,duringthewar,amessagecamefrommycompany.Tonyhadpassedaway.
Iaskedourpeopletocheckonhisfamilyandseethateverythingwasproperlyhandled.Theyfoundthefarmgreenwithvegetables,thelittlehouselivableandhomey.Therewasatractorandagoodcarintheyard.Thechildrenwereeducatedandworking,andTonydidn'toweacent.
Afterhepassedaway,IthoughtmoreandmoreaboutTony'scareer.Hegrewinstatureinmymind.Intheend,Ithinkhestoodastall,andasproud,asthegreatestAmericanindustrialists.
Theyhadallreachedtheirsuccessbythesamerouteandbythesamevaluesandprinciples:vision,determination,self-control,optimism,self-respectand,aboveall,integrity.
Tonydidnotbeginonthebottomrungoftheladder.Hebeganinthebasement.Tony'saffairsweretiny;thegreatestindustrialists'affairsweregiant.But,afterall,thebalancesheetswereexactlythesame.Theonlydifferencewaswhereyouputthedecimalpoint.
TonyTrivisonnocametoAmericaseekingtheAmericanDream.Buthedidn'tfindithecreateditforhimself.Allhehadwere24precioushoursaday,andhewastednoneofthem.
